Vintage Atikamekw Birch Bark Rogan Box Indigenous Lidded Container Manawan, Quebec art glass the tin is quite oldTraditional birch bark rogan (lidded container, traditionally used to store picked berries), attributed to the Atikamekw (Attikamek) people of Manawan, Quebec, and accompanied by an original handwritten French tag documenting the piece in December 1979. The rogan is hand constructed from folded birch bark, stitched with spruce root, reinforced with cedar splints, and fitted with a moose hide carrying strap.
